This technical note explains how to resolve
a problem with LabelVision 2000 version 3.1 multi-user editions.
If you are using LabelVision 2000 version 3.1 with a five or greater
user license, you may see the following error message, even though
you have not exceeded the licensed number of users:
LabelVision 2000 has detected another user of your license
on the network. The application will be shut down.
If this happens, you probably need to get an updated License Manager.
To check if you need an update
- Using the Windows Explorer, open the LabelVision 2000 client
installation folder.
- Right-click on the file PrtOnly.exe, then select "Properties".
- Click on the Version tab. Write down the Print Only version.
- Right-click on the file LcnsMgr.exe, then select "Properties".
- Click on the Version tab. Write down the License Manager version.
- If the Print Only version is 3.1.362.0 and the License
Manager version is 3.1.362.0, then you must download an update
to the License manager.
Do not download an update unless both file versions are exactly
as shown in step 6!
To download the update
- Quit all LabelVision programs.

- When prompted by your browser, choose save to file. Save the
file on your hard drive. You may find it convenient to save it
in the LabelVision server folder.
- Copy this updated LcnsMgr.exe to each of your LabelVision
client installation folders, overwriting the existing file.
- Check the LcnsMgr.exe version in each client installation folder.
It should be 3.1.385.0.
- Delete the file ticket.dat in the LabelVision server folder.
- If you install a new LabelVision client, be sure to check the
version and copy the updated LcnsMgr.exe to the client installation
folder after installing if necessary.
